GridForge account recovery (release manager only). If the signing account for the crossword generator is locked after three failed attempts, do not reset via the console; that wipes pending puzzle batches. Instead, open the recovery prompt on the build host and wait for the challenge screen. Enter the recovery passphrase exactly as written below.

strongbox words: norwyn-wenael-aldvan-aldiel-wendor-holael

## Onboarding: Flaky Integration Tests in Tollgate Payments

Tollgate's integration suite flakes mostly in the settlement tests — they depend on the Brindle sandbox, which throttles after 50 requests/minute. Retries are automatic; two consecutive failures means a real problem. Don't advise customers based on a single red build. To rerun the suite against the sandbox, unlock the test credentials store, which prompts for the recovery passphrase:

unlock words, hahip-baduf: holwyn-istath-julvan

Before signing off on a Glimmerforge release, run the GPU memory profiler against the staging canary for at least one full inference cycle. Watch for the sawtooth pattern — that's normal; a steady climb is not. If peak allocation exceeds 90% of the card's budget, hold the release and ping the kernels pod. Don't trust the dashboard alone; pull raw traces. The profiler setup and flag reference live on our internal page.

runbook for yaguf-bafop: https://jira.tolvaqsys.internal/browse/browse/pages/8858f4b3